Function & Operational Principles
The primary function of the Honghua HHF 1000 Liner Spraying Assembly is to cool the pump’s liner by delivering a uniform spray of cooling fluid (typically water or a water-glycol mixture) across the liner’s surface. The assembly operates through a simple, reliable mechanism: the 32PL Spraying Pump generates pressure to push cooling fluid through the hoses (L=1500 and L=480) and connectors, which are routed to the water case (GH3101-08.12.00) and case cover (GH3101-08.13.00).
Structural Features
- Durable Protective Shield (GH3101-08.01.00A): Constructed from carbon steel with a corrosion-resistant coating, the shield protects the assembly from drilling dust, mud, and fluid splatter. It is designed to withstand high impact and vibration (up to 4g), ensuring long-term structural integrity.
- Reliable Power Transmission: The GH3101-08.02 Belt Pulley is made from cast iron, paired with two GB117-74 V Belts (A3150) that deliver consistent power transfer with minimal slippage. The belts are resistant to heat and wear, with a service life of 4,000+ operating hours.
- Leak-Proof Fluid Transfer: Hoses (L=1500 and L=480) are made from nitrile rubber with reinforced nylon layers, resistant to high pressure (up to 30MPa) and chemical corrosion from drilling fluids. The GH3101-08.09.00 Hose Joints (Φ22XΦ37) and NPT connectors create a tight seal, preventing fluid leakage.
- Efficient Spraying Pump (32PL): The 32PL Spraying Pump delivers a consistent flow rate of 15–20 L/min, ensuring uniform cooling of the liner. It is designed for continuous operation, with a service life of 7,000+ operating hours under normal conditions.
- Controllable Flow Valve (Q11F-16): The Q11F-16 Internal Thread Ball Valve allows precise control of cooling fluid flow, with a maximum pressure rating of 16MPa. It features a durable ball and seat design, ensuring reliable operation and easy maintenance.
- Secure Fastening System: All bolts, nuts, and washers (including 5/8-11UNC, 1/2-13UNC) are manufactured to American and GB standards, with heat-treated steel for tensile strength up to 1040MPa. Clamps (No.3) secure hoses in place, preventing movement under vibration.
Maintenance & Care Recommendations
Proper maintenance of the liner spraying assembly is critical to ensuring effective liner cooling and preventing premature failure. Follow these practical, on-site guidelines:
- Inspect all hoses (L=1500 and L=480) every 200 operating hours for cracks, leaks, or wear. Replace worn hoses with our compatible parts and ensure hose joints (GH3101-08.09.00) are tight to prevent leakage.
- Check the V belts (GB117-74 A3150) every 300 operating hours for tension and wear. Adjust tension if loose (recommended tension: 50–60 N) and replace belts if they show signs of cracking or fraying.
- Clean the 32PL Spraying Pump every 500 operating hours to remove debris that could restrict fluid flow. Inspect the pump’s internal components and replace worn parts with our compatible spares.
- Test the Q11F-16 Ball Valve every 400 operating hours to ensure it opens and closes smoothly. Clean the valve to remove any buildup and replace it if it leaks or fails to control flow.
- Inspect all bolts, nuts, and clamps every 200 operating hours for tightness. Tighten loose fasteners to the recommended torque (80 N·m for 5/8-11UNC bolts, 60 N·m for 1/2-13UNC bolts) and replace worn parts.
- Flush the entire spraying system every 800 operating hours to remove scale and debris. Refill with clean cooling fluid and inspect the water case (GH3101-08.12.00) for corrosion.
- Store spare parts in a clean, dry environment (0°C–25°C) to prevent corrosion. Keep hoses and rubber components away from sharp objects and extreme temperatures.

On-Site Fault Maintenance Cases
Case 1: Liner Overheating Due to Clogged Spraying Pump
Scenario: An onshore rig reported excessive liner temperature (130°C) and increased pump noise. The liner spraying assembly was not delivering cooling fluid, leading to rapid liner wear.
Root Cause: The 32PL Spraying Pump was clogged with scale and debris, preventing fluid flow. The pump had not been cleaned for 700 operating hours, exceeding the recommended 500-hour interval.
Solution: Cleaned the spraying pump and replaced the clogged internal components with our compatible parts. Flushed the hoses and connectors, and refilled the system with clean cooling fluid. After maintenance, liner temperature dropped to 75°C, and liner wear decreased by 75%.
Case 2: Fluid Leakage from Hose Joints
Scenario: A drilling team noticed cooling fluid leakage from the liner spraying assembly, leading to reduced cooling efficiency and increased water consumption.
Root Cause: The GH3101-08.09.00 Hose Joints (Φ22XΦ37) were worn, creating loose connections. The hoses had also degraded due to exposure to drilling fluid, causing small cracks.
Solution: Replaced the worn hose joints and damaged hoses with our compatible parts. Tightened all connections and inspected the entire fluid path for additional leaks. The leakage stopped completely, cooling efficiency was restored, and water consumption decreased by 85%.
Case 3: V Belt Slippage & Pump Failure
Scenario: An offshore rig experienced a failure of the 32PL Spraying Pump, as the belt pulley was not transferring power effectively. The liner overheated, forcing a rig shutdown.
Root Cause: The GB117-74 V Belts (A3150) were worn and loose, causing slippage and preventing the spraying pump from operating at full capacity. The belt tension had not been checked for 400 operating hours.
Solution: Replaced the worn V belts with our compatible GB117-74 A3150 belts and adjusted the tension to 55 N. Inspected the belt pulley (GH3101-08.02) for wear and tightened its fasteners. The spraying pump resumed normal operation, liner temperature stabilized, and the rig was back online within 2 hours.
